Built in the late 1800s, this hotel was originally known as the Brandt Hotel. This hotel sheltered the railroad crews and almost every hotel service for travelers during the years. At one time the hotel was refurbished with old furnishings to make it a pleasant and quaint place to eat. The current owner is now in the process of refurbishing it again to be operated as a bed and breakfast.

Wabaunsee County Court House

This beautiful building was constructed in 1931. It is constructed of Carthage and native stone. The Carthage stone, used on the outside for facing, gives the appearance of a granite building. All outside walls are backed up with eight inches of native stone.
